I agree with some earlier posts that the lopsided and unbalanced design already makes SJP such a unique stadium right at the heart of the city.

 

But to compete with the likes of Liverpool, Spurs, West Ham and maybe even Everton, an extension would probably be needed and if we suddenly become an ambitious or even a successful club, a great looking stadium would help. Especially as the chance to expand the Gallowgate might be wiped out forever. We should never move away from SJP.

 

The 3rd phase in the image below is of course virtually impossible

 

http://i186.photobucket.com/albums/x11/MartinLeRoy/Combined.jpg

Going back to this, I've found a forum on where the guy made these graphics/models of a SJP with extended Gallowgate End and East Stand. If the Gallowgate was extended, it would take the capacity to 61,188. And, although it's pretty much impossible due to the listed buildings behind it, if the East Stand was extended also, the capacity would be taken to 81,219.
